Shower Drain Installation in Denver, CO
Shower drain installation services involve setting up or replacing drains that efficiently carry water away from a shower area, helping to prevent water buildup and potential damage. These projects typically cover new bathroom constructions, bathroom remodels, or repairs of existing drains that are clogged, leaking, or draining slowly. Homeowners interested in this service should understand the importance of proper drain placement, appropriate sizing, and the need for reliable piping connections to ensure effective drainage and prevent future issues.
Before requesting shower drain installation, property owners often want to know about the types of drains suitable for their bathroom setup, the materials used, and the compatibility with existing plumbing systems. It’s also helpful to consider factors like accessibility for maintenance, the impact on bathroom aesthetics, and any necessary permits or codes that might influence the installation process. Clear information about these aspects can assist in making informed decisions and ensuring the project aligns with the overall bathroom design and plumbing requirements.

Shower Drain Installation Questions
What is involved in shower drain installation? The process includes removing the old drain, preparing the area, and installing a new drain that fits the shower base and plumbing system.
Can a new shower drain improve drainage performance? Yes, a properly installed drain helps prevent clogs and ensures efficient water flow from the shower.
What types of shower drains are available? Options include linear drains, point drains, and trench drains, each suited to different shower designs and preferences.
Is professional installation necessary for shower drains? Professional installation ensures proper fitting, sealing, and compliance with plumbing standards for reliable operation.
